Hatari - spec512.c
|
|
|
|
This file is distributed under the GNU General Public License, version 2
|
|
or at your option any later version. Read the file gpl.txt for details.
|
|
|
|
Handle storing of writes to ST palette using clock-cycle counts. We can use
|
|
this to accurately any form of Spectrum512 style images - even down to the
|
|
way the screen colours change on decompression routines in menus!
|
|
|
|
As the 68000 has a 4-clock cycle increment we can only change palette every
|
|
4 cycles. This means that on one scanline (512 cycles in 50Hz) we have just
|
|
512/4=128 places where palette writes can take place. We keep track of this
|
|
in a table (storing on each scanline and color writes and the cycles on the
|
|
scanline where they happen). When we draw the screen we simply keep a
|
|
cycle-count on the line and check this with our table and update the 16-color
|
|
palette with each change. As the table is already ordered this makes things
|
|
very simple. Speed is a problem, though, as the palette can change once every
|
|
4 pixels - that's a lot of processing.
|
|
*/

/* 2008/01/12 [NP] In Spec512_StoreCyclePalette, don't use Cycles_GetCounterOnWriteAccess */
|
|
/* as it doesn't support movem for example. Use Cycles_GetCounter with */
|
|
/* an average correction of 8 cycles (this should be fixed). */
|
|
/* In Spec512_StartScanLine, better handling of SCREENBYTES_LEFT when */
|
|
/* border are present. Better alignement of pixel and color when left */
|
|
/* border is removed (Rotofull in Nostalgia Demo, When Colors Are Going */
|
|
/* Bang Bang by DF in Punish Your Machine). */
|
|
/* 2008/01/13 [NP] In Spec512_StoreCyclePalette, if a movem was used to access several */
|
|
/* color regs just before the end of a line, the value for nHorPos was not */
|
|
/* checked and could take values >= 512, which means some colors in the */
|
|
/* palette were overwritten next time colors were stored on the next line */
|
|
/* and the palette was not set correctly, especially in the bottom of the */
|
|
/* screen (Decade Demo Main Menu, Punish Your Machine Main Menu, ULM */
|
|
/* Hidden Screen in Oh Crickey...). */
|
|
/* 2008/01/13 [NP] One line should contain 512/4 + 1 colors slots, not 512/4. Else, if */
|
|
/* a program manages to change colors every 4 cycles, the '-1' terminator */
|
|
/* added by Spec512_StartFrame will in fact be written on cycle 0 in the */
|
|
/* next line (this is theorical, practically no program changes the color */
|
|
/* 128 times per line). */
|
|
/* Use nCyclesPerLine instead of 512 to check if nHorPos is too big and if */
|
|
/* the colors must be stored on the next line when freq is 50 or 60Hz */
|
|
/* (readme.prg by TEX (in 1987)) */
|
|
/* 2008/01/24 [NP] In Spec512_StartScanLine, use different values for LineStartCycle when */
|
|
/* running in 50 Hz or 60 Hz (TEX Spectrum Slideshow in 60 Hz). */
|
|
/* 2008/12/14 [NP] In Spec512_StoreCyclePalette, instead of approximating write position */
|
|
/* by Cycles_GetCounter+8, we use different cases for movem, .l acces and */
|
|
/* .w acces (similar to cycles.c). This gives correct results when using */
|
|
/* "move.w d0,(a0) or move.w (a0)+,(a1)+" for example, which were shifted */
|
|
/* 8 or 4 pixels too late. Calibration was made using a custom program to */
|
|
/* compare the results with a real STF in different cases (fix Froggies */
|
|
/* Over The Fence Main Menu). */
|
|
/* 2008/12/21 [NP] Use BusMode to adjust Cycles_GetCounterOnReadAccess and */
|
|
/* Cycles_GetCounterOnWriteAccess depending on who is owning the */
|
|
/* bus (cpu, blitter). */
|
|
/* 2009/07/28 [NP] Use different timings for movem.l and movem.w */
|
|
/* 2014/01/02 [NP] In Spec512_StoreCyclePalette, write occurs during the last cycles for */
|
|
/* i_ADD and i_SUB (fix 'add d1,(a0)' in '4-pixel plasma' by TOS Crew). */
